Iowa State Women Seek Positivity Amid Ongoing Losing Streak

The Iowa State women’s basketball team is currently facing a challenging situation as they aim for positivity amid a notable losing streak. Following a 68-62 defeat against Colorado on January 14, they have now dropped four consecutive games. The Cyclones are confronting the team’s longest losing streak in nearly a decade and seek to recapture their earlier success.

Iowa State Cyclones: Current Struggles and Injuries

Under the guidance of Coach Bill Fennelly, the team is determined to maintain a positive outlook. “If you’re not going to come in and put the work in with a positive attitude, then you shouldn’t be here,” Fennelly emphasized, motivating his players to commit fully. This encouragement came after a solid practice day on January 16, following a rare off-day.

After an impressive start to the season with a record of 14 straight wins, Iowa State has fallen to a 14-4 overall record and 2-4 in Big 12 play. The absence of key players has heavily impacted the team’s performance. Forward Addy Brown and guard Arianna Jackson are both sidelined due to injuries, creating significant gaps in the lineup.

Injury Impact on the Team

  • Addy Brown: Out indefinitely due to a lower body injury.
  • Arianna Jackson: Also out, recovering from a knee injury.

Both players have been instrumental to the team’s early success, and their absence has been felt during recent defeats against Baylor, Cincinnati, West Virginia, and Colorado. Coach Fennelly expressed concern over the team’s identity crisis due to the changes in their roster. “We’ve completely changed our team and obviously not in a very good way,” he remarked.

The Upcoming Challenge

The Cyclones will face a formidable opponent in Oklahoma State on January 18, known for their explosive offense. With an average of 87.9 points per game, Oklahoma State ranks first in the Big 12 for team free throw percentage at 77.3%. Five players score in double figures, creating a significant challenge for Iowa State’s defense.

Game Strategies

With the team struggling especially on defense, especially in the post, slowing down Oklahoma State will be crucial. The recent strategy adjustments include focusing on better ball movement and finding alternative scoring methods, particularly for standout player Audi Crooks, who has not performed at her usual level following the injuries.

Historical Context

This current four-game losing streak is the first for Iowa State since the 2017-18 season, signifying the urgency for a turnaround. In that year, the Cyclones also lost four games in a row and ended with a 14-17 season record. The last instance of a five-game losing streak occurred during the 2015-16 season, further emphasizing the need for the team to regain their footing quickly.
